Categories of Dental Implant Equipment


Dental implant equipment includes a range of professional tools created to aid in the surgical placement and restoration of dental implants. One of the key items is the implant kit, which holds instruments such as surgical drills, handpieces, and a selection of abutment drivers. These tools allow the precise placement of the implant and are designed to create the necessary osteotomy in the jawbone for ideal stability.


Another crucial category of dental implant equipment includes imaging and diagnostic tools. Cone beam computed tomography (CBCT) is a breakthrough in this realm, offering three-dimensional imaging of the jaw and surrounding structures. This technology allows dental professionals to examine bone quality and quantity, plan the implant placement thoroughly, and identify any anatomical considerations that may influence surgery.


Finally, the restorative aspect of dental implants requires dedicated equipment for creating crowns, bridges, and dentures. CAD/CAM systems are essential in this phase, permitting for digital design and fabrication of restorations that match seamlessly with the implants. Alongside these systems, laboratories utilize various handpieces and tools for finishing and polishing, ensuring that the final restorations are not only functional but also aesthetically pleasing.


Main Features and Functions


Implantology equipment is designed to streamline the complete process of dental implants, from initial assessment to final restoration. One of the key tools in this field is the implant surgical kit, which typically contains drills, implant drivers, and an assortment of instruments designed for the exact positioning of dental implants. The drill system guarantees ideal site preparation by forming a pathway in the bone that corresponds to the dimensions of the dental implant, while the implant drivers enable firm positioning of the prosthetic into the operational area.


Another essential component of dental implant equipment is imaging systems. Cone beam computed tomography (CBCT) offers incredible detail of a patient’s bone and soft tissue anatomy, allowing for effective planning and assessment of the site for implantation. High-precision imaging helps in detecting bone density, vital anatomical landmarks, and risk factors, which ultimately enhances the success rate of the implants placed. High-quality imaging tools are crucial for ensuring that clinicians can make well-informed decisions.


Finally, dental implant equipment includes restorative parts such as abutments, crowns, and other elements. These components are essential for completing the implant process, as they provide the essential link between the implant and the tooth on display. Abutments are crafted to attach securely to the implant, while dental crowns are designed to align with the natural teeth in both esthetics and practicality. This feature of dental implant equipment not just aids cosmetic results but also secures the durability over time and operational capacity of the dental restoration.


Upkeep and Protection Guidelines


To guarantee the lifespan and efficacy of dental implant devices, regular maintenance is essential. All equipment should be disinfected and purified after each use to avoid infection and disease. Following the supplier’s recommendations for maintenance is essential, as specific equipment may have unique cleansing agents or protocols. Keeping an organized workspace and routinely checking the quality of your tools can help identify any wear before it impacts patient care.


Protective measures is a top priority when using with dental implant devices. Dentists should always wear appropriate personal protective gear, such as gloves, masks, and safety goggles, to reduce risk to blood and contaminants. Additionally, it is vital to handle sharp tools carefully and to dispose of any used needles or blades in designated sharps containers to avoid incidental injuries. Training staff on protective protocols and safety procedures can help create a safer working environment.
